Steelers Sign CB DeMarcus Van Dyke

Jerry Dulac of the Post-Gazette reports that the Steelers have signed CB DeMarcus Van Dyke after having him in for a workout this morning. DVD spent time on the roster last year, and saw mostly limited snaps on special teams, during a  handful of games.  He was with the team in training camp this summer, but suffered a serious hamstring injury during the last week of July. Van Dyke is a speedster, who ran a 4.28 40 yd during his 2011 combine.  Bringing in Van Dyke is a depth move as Ike Taylor is recovering from concussion symptoms this week.
